Hi, Has been awhile since I have played BG2...

And I have i question:


Can I store some thing(like the Powwel Jem) in a Chest or a box at ex Waukeen's Promenade or will it disappear?

Yes, you can safely store it there. After chapter 6, I think some places are refreshed, and I'm not sure if this includes WP. If the place refreshes, the items disappear. You should just store the items in your stronghold.

You should not store items in strongholds because those are the ones that get changed. You could lose your items if you place them in a container before you acquire the stronghold (area changes after you acquire it). After you acquire the stronghold you're safe to store there anything you want.

Any item in a container in Waukeen promenade is safe. That's where i stored mine. so is slums district, tested this too. In fact I'm fairly sure every outside area is okay and most of the inside ones. Only ones that I'm sure change are strongholds (as mentioned above) and bodhi's lair tombs (change in chapter 6).

Yeah, pre-empting strongholds is generally a bad idea. The only one that I know doesn't change is the cleric stronghold. I don't know if the paladin one changes (I don't see why it should), and the druid stronghold is irrelevant as it contains no containers. Warrior and ranger definately changes, and I want to say mage changes, but I could be wrong. Jury's out on the bards.

When I store things I generally use the table and/or crate in the copper coronet. The crate usually gets the one time use and now completely useless items like keys and fishy orbs.

I just fine it a conveniently located place, the story line is regularly sending the party back to the Coronet and its easy to et to and has the benefit of having a couple merchants and a room to rest in.
